Now is time to get back on your fitness program, clean out the left-over's, and restart your healthy diet so you are ready for the rest of the holidays.

Here are my top tips for Post Thanksgiving:

  1. clean out the frig thanksgiving dietClean out the bad stuff from the refrigerator.  This includes everything made with a ton of butter or sugar.  Sugar and butter are horible for your weight loss program and should be dumped from the refrigerator now.  Doing this is best for the entire family.  Thanksgiving is over this year.
  2. Dump the rolls...that is all they are good for on your body;-)  Get back to the grains and whole grain breads (if you have any breads at all).  Thanksgiving is over this year.
  3. Restock.  Time to go to the grocery store and restock your shelves with all the goodies you need for a solid diet:
    • Healthy Grains
    • Veggies
    • Lean Meats
    • Fruits
    • Good Stuff!
    • Thanksgiving is over this year.
  4. Prepare.  Time to get your foods for the week ready to go.  Do your cooking and set your meal plan for the week.  Thanksgiving is over this year.
  5. Use good leftovers. 
    • Pick the turkey clean and use the meat for your diet, it is great tasting and great for your weight loss diet!
    • Use the bones in a soup.  Load veggies and wild rice into a pot and cook them up into a nice thick soup that will be healthy, filling, nutritious, and good.workout after thanksgiving
